from djangorestframework.compat import RequestFactory
class TestRotation(TestCase):
"""For the example the maximum amount of Blogposts is capped off at 10.
Whenever a new Blogpost is posted the oldest one should be popped."""
def setUp(self):
self.factory = RequestFactory()
def test_get_to_root(self):
'''Simple test to demonstrate how the requestfactory needs to be used'''
request = self.factory.get('/blog-post')
view = views.BlogPosts.as_view()
response = view(request)
self.assertEqual(response.status_code, 200)
def test_blogposts_not_exceed_10(self):
'''Posting blogposts should not result in more than 10 items stored.'''
models.BlogPost.objects.all().delete()
for post in range(15):
form_data = {'title': 'This is post #%s' % post, 'content': 'This is the content of post #%s' % post}
request = self.factory.post('/blog-post', data=form_data)
view = views.BlogPosts.as_view()
response = view(request)
self.assertEquals(len(models.BlogPost.objects.all()),10)
